Overview

Honey Bun is an evenly-balanced hybrid cannabis strain (50% indica/50% sativa) created by the renowned breeding team at Cookies in collaboration with Seed Junky Genetics. This strain is a cross between Gelatti and Honey B, resulting in a potent cultivar that has gained significant popularity in the cannabis community for its exceptional flavor profile and balanced effects. The strain gets its name from the beloved classic treat due to its extremely sweet and tasty flavors that genuinely resemble a honey-glazed donut.

The buds of Honey Bun are visually striking, featuring dense, heart-shaped nuggets with bright green and yellow colors underscored by vibrant orange pistils. The flowers are heavily coated in frosty white crystal trichomes, giving them a sticky, resinous appearance that indicates their potency. The strain typically produces medium-height plants with robust, manageable growth characteristics, making it suitable for both indoor and outdoor cultivation. With THC levels ranging from 17-24%, Honey Bun delivers a potent experience that requires moderation, especially for novice users.

Growing Information

Honey Bun is considered moderately easy to grow, making it suitable for both novice and experienced cultivators. The strain has a flowering time of 8-9 weeks indoors, with some growers reporting harvest readiness as early as 7 weeks under optimal conditions. Indoor yields typically range from 450-550 grams per square meter (1.47-1.82 oz/ft²). Outdoor growers can expect harvests around late September to early October, with plants reaching medium height and producing up to 450 grams per plant. The strain thrives in warm, sunny conditions with temperatures between 70-80°F (21-27°C) and moderate humidity levels. It prefers well-draining soil and benefits from proper support structures due to its dense, heavy buds. The plants require consistent lighting (18-20 hours during vegetative stage, 12/12 for flowering) and respond well to training techniques like ScrOG for optimal yields.
